Kistos Holdings Days Payable Calculation

Days Payable indicates the number of days that the account payable relative to cost of goods sold the company has. An increase of Days Payable may suggest that the company delays paying its suppliers.

Kistos Holdings's Days Payable for the fiscal year that ended in Dec. 2024 is calculated as

Days Payable (A: Dec. 2024 )
=Average Accounts Payable /Cost of Goods Sold*Days in Period
=( (Accounts Payable (A: Dec. 2023 ) + Accounts Payable (A: Dec. 2024 )) / count ) / Cost of Goods Sold (A: Dec. 2024 )*Days in Period
=( (6.822 + 4.427) / 2 ) / 104.562*365
=5.6245 / 104.562*365
=19.63

Kistos Holdings's Days Payable for the quarter that ended in Jun. 2025 is calculated as:

Days Payable (Q: Jun. 2025 )
=Average Accounts Payable / Cost of Goods Sold*Days in Period
=( (Accounts Payable (Q: Dec. 2024 ) + Accounts Payable (Q: Jun. 2025 )) / count ) / Cost of Goods Sold (Q: Jun. 2025 )*Days in Period
=( (4.427 + 9.487) / 2 ) / 55.301*365 / 2
=6.957 / 55.301*365 / 2
=22.96

Kistos Holdings Business Description

Industry EnergyOil & Gas
Other Exchanges KIST:UKLU0:Germany
Address 3 St James's Square, 2nd Floor, London, GBR, SW1Y 4JU
Kistos Holdings PLC is established to create value for its investors through the acquisition and management of companies or businesses in the energy sector. Its principal area of activity is the acquisition and operation of companies or businesses in the energy sector, with a focus on upstream oil and gas activities. The company's reportable segments are; the Netherlands, comprising the production and sale of gas and other hydrocarbons in the Q10-A field and the related costs; the Norway segment comprises the production of oil from interests in the Balder and Ringhorne Ost fields offshore Norway; and the UK segment represents the production and sale of gas and other hydrocarbons from its interest in GLA and related costs.
